There are 51 Lazy Dog Restaurant & Bar locations in the United States of America as of December 01, 2025. The state or territory with the most Lazy Dog Restaurant & Bar locations is California, with 24 sites, accounting for roughly 47.1% of the total.


Lazy Dog Restaurant & Bar operates 51 United States of America locations across 8 states. Largest clusters are in California, Texas, and Illinois; the top 10 states contain 100.0% of sites. Coverage is thinner in Florida, Georgia, and Virginia.

Lazy Dog Restaurant & Bar has 51 locations across the United States, with nearly half (47.1%) situated in California, totaling 24 locations. Texas and Illinois follow with 9 and 5 locations respectively, together accounting for 74.5% of all sites in the top three states. Nevada, Colorado, and California offer the best access, with populations per location ranging from approximately 1.03 to 1.64 million. In contrast, Florida, Georgia, and Virginia have the most stretched coverage, with populations per location exceeding 4.3 million.
Locations concentrate around major metros such as Los Angeles, Orange, Clark, Cook, and Fort Bend. The top 10 cities account for 51.0% of U.S. sites.

Lazy Dog Restaurant & Bar operates 51 locations across the United States, with 51% of these concentrated in the top 10 cities. Los Angeles, California, leads with 6 locations, followed by Orange, California, and Clark, Nevada, each with 3. Several other cities, including Cook, Illinois, and Fort Bend, Texas, have 2 locations each.

Lazy Dog Restaurant & Bar has the most locations in California, which covers 423,965 km² with 24 locations. Texas is the largest state by land area at 695,668 km² but has only 9 locations. Virginia, the smallest state listed at 110,786 km², has 2 locations. Other states like Illinois, Colorado, Nevada, Florida, and Georgia have between 2 and 5 locations each.

Lazy Dog Restaurant & Bar operates exclusively open locations across eight states in the United States, with no closures reported. California leads with 24 open restaurants, followed by Texas with 9, and Illinois with 5. Each state maintains a 100% open status, reflecting consistent business operations nationwide.

Lazy Dog Restaurant & Bar's busiest locations are distributed across eight states in the United States. California has the highest number of busy locations with 7 out of 24, representing 29.2%. Georgia, Florida, and Virginia each have 50% of their locations marked as busy, the highest percentage among the states listed. Illinois has 2 busy locations, accounting for 40% of its total.

Lazy Dog Restaurant & Bar has its highest average ratings of 4.6 in Illinois and Virginia. Colorado, Florida, and Nevada follow closely with average ratings of 4.5. California leads in review volume with 72,983, while Texas and Colorado also have substantial review counts of 30,625 and 19,611 respectively.
